THE MISSION
Something strange and sinister has manifested deep within the ocean. Your government has taken to calling it the "anomaly", and has assembled a small crew to take an advanced scout submarine and investigate. Your role is to man the Yudi-15 System Control program, an advanced software that manages the power and operations of the vessel.POWER UP YOUR SYSTEMS
Add and remove power to different systems on your vessel, depending on what the situation calls for. Power up your weapons to swiftly defeat your enemies, or power up the engines and make a run for it! When the systems take damage, be sure you send your mechanic to keep them repaired. The integrity of your vessel, and the outcome of the mission, depends on how you choose to prioritize.ENGAGE HOSTILE FORCES
Encounter a myriad of hostile forces as you progress deeper into the ocean. Rival governments seek reach the target before you, and won't hesitate to take you out. It seems the anomaly is causing disturbances throughout the ocean as well, enraging wild life. Use an arsenal of torpedoes and nuclear warheads to blast your way through increasingly dangerous and disturbing entities as you descend deeper.RESPOND TO THE ENVIRONMENT
Nobody knows what you might encounter on the mission. Should you dip into a nearby tunnel system and avoid an enemy patrol, or go straight in and try to out run them? Work with your crew and make choices on how to proceed as you encounter a wide variety of scenarios. Each run is different, so stay vigilant.Analog Controls
Everything in the game is controlled via physical buttons, switches, and dials. Feel as though you are actually an operator inside the submarine manning a console.Can you traverse the dangers of the ocean and reach the anomaly, or will you fail your country?
